## Formula sandbox tuning

User-supplied formulas in Gridmoor execute inside a restricted interpreter with hard ceilings on time, memory, and call depth. Reviewers should confirm any change to these ceilings is justified in the PR description, since raising them widens the abuse surface. Defaults were chosen from production traces. The current limits are as follows.

limits module of tafog-fawip:
WEIGHTS = {
    "julix": 57,
    "lamys": 992,
    "kasvan": 209,
    "quenok": 750,
    "alddor": 259,
    "oliath": 1009,
    "wenix": 815,
}

Welcome to the Contrast Audit team at Pellwick Studio. Each quarter we run a full color-contrast accessibility audit across the Lumabrand component library, checking every text and icon pairing against our internal thresholds. New members should start with the audit spreadsheet owned by the Foreground squad and flag any ratio below 4.5:1. Results are stored in the Tintvault archive, which requires the team recovery credentials for first-time access. The passphrase you will need to unlock the archive appears directly below.

unlock words, fajog-yagag: belix-ralwyn-quenys-druix-tamion

MEMO — Kettling Depot Receiving

Uniform sets for the new Kettling depot arrive Wednesday via Ashgrove courier: 40 boxes, sorted by size, manifest attached to box one. Check the count at the dock before signing; shortages go straight to stores, not the courier. The hand-over instruction the courier will follow is set out below.

drop instructions, tafof-baguf: the holmir gilox courier leaves the sormir ulaok holdor ledger at gate 5596 under passcode 257343

Runbook fragment — Release 9.3, Carthwell Gateway

Known issue: internal DNS for the artifact mirror resolves flakily under load; verification can fetch stale manifests. Mitigation: pin resolver to the static pool, retry twice, then fail closed. Do not bypass signature checks under any circumstances. Security review must confirm the resolver pin is active before promotion. Hash the fetched bundle, compare against the release manifest, then verify with the signing key below.

release key, fajef-kajeg: bky19_LdLu6Ne6FLi8he2c24d